The most immediate risk to a user of hdmovie2do is not a lawsuit, but the infection of their device. The aggressive advertising model creates a dangerous environment where malicious actors can thrive.
While the lack of a monthly subscription fee is highly appealing to users, navigating sites like HDMovie2do exposes visitors to significant digital and legal hazards. 1. Malware and Cybersecurity Threats

: The site uses deceptive interfaces that mimic legitimate video players. Users are often redirected to fraudulent landing pages claiming their device is infected or prompting them to enter credit card details for verification.
: To survive, the administrators deploy proxy or mirror networks. They constantly change the domain suffix (e.g., from .com to .to , .is , or .cc ) to bypass local ISP blocks.
